About Michael Peake

Michael Peake is a scholar working on Pulmonary and Respiratory Medicine, Oncology and Dermatology, having authored 115 papers that have together received 3.1k indexed citations. Recurring topics across this work include Lung Cancer Treatments and Mutations (37 papers), Lung Cancer Diagnosis and Treatment (33 papers), Global Cancer Incidence and Screening (27 papers), Lung Cancer Research Studies (16 papers), Gastric Cancer Management and Outcomes (11 papers), Neuroendocrine Tumor Research Advances (9 papers), Occupational and environmental lung diseases (8 papers) and Pleural and Pulmonary Diseases (7 papers). The work is most often cited by research in Oncology (1.4k citations), Pulmonary and Respiratory Medicine (1.7k citations) and Otorhinolaryngology (70 citations). Michael Peake has collaborated with scholars based in United Kingdom, Sweden and United States. Frequent co-authors include Henrik Møller, Margreet Lüchtenborg, Sharma P. Riaz, Sean McPhail, Richard Stephens, Victoria H. Coupland, David Waller, Mahesh Parmar, Stephen Spiro and Robert Milroy. Their work appears in journals such as Lung Cancer, Thorax, British Journal of Cancer, Journal of Thoracic Oncology and BMJ Open.
